about

Murayama Kentaro is a potter who makes pottery in Karatsu, Saga Prefecture. He walks the mountains himself to collect the raw materials such as soil, iron, and stone. The designs are simple in shape to fit in with modern food culture and to be used for a long time. Made from refined white clay collected in the Kawahara area. It is made with a glaze made from feldspar collected in the Yamauchi area.

artisit info

Murayama Kentaro 

Born in Karatsu City, Saga Prefecture in 1978. Graduated from Arita Ceramics College in 2003 and studied under Kiyomi Kawakami. Established his own kiln in Karatsu City in 2008. He walks in the mountains, gathers raw materials, makes clay and glazes, and while using the old Karatsu storefront techniques as a base, he continues to research soil and glazes to create his own unique texture.
